Committee members press for rules and ballot fixes after district meeting ran to 1 a.m.
Summary
Members said the recent district meeting ran exceptionally long and proposed options — including limiting late warrant-article introductions, restricting ballot votes to financially substantive articles, adding ballot boxes, or tabling items after a set time — to prevent future meetings from being 'hijacked.'
Several committee members raised concerns that a recent district meeting, which ran until about 1 a.m., was excessively long and could discourage public participation.
